1. To limit the use of funds to support NATO Operation Unified Protector with respect to Libya - Vote Failed (180–238, 13 Not Voting)
House Resolution 2378
To limit the use of funds appropriated to the Department of Defense for United States Armed Forces in support of North Atlantic Treaty Organization Operation Unified Protector with respect to Libya, unless otherwise specifically authorized by law

2. Libya Troop Withdrawal - Vote Failed
(148–265, 19 Not Voting)
The House failed to pass this resolution
that would have forced the withdrawal of
U.S. combat forces from Libya within 15 days.
